导入数据库的是什么东西

worktile 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    导入数据库是将外部数据文件或其他数据库中的数据导入到一个数据库中的过程。它是一种常见的操作,可以用于将数据从一个系统迁移到另一个系统,或者将数据合并到一个统一的数据库中。以下是关于导入数据库的一些重要信息:

    1. 数据库导入工具:常用的数据库管理系统(如MySQL、Oracle、SQL Server等)都提供了相应的导入工具,可以通过这些工具将数据导入到数据库中。这些工具通常提供了多种导入方式,例如从文件导入、从其他数据库导入等。

    2. 数据导入格式:在导入数据之前,需要将数据转换为数据库支持的格式。常见的数据导入格式包括CSV(逗号分隔值)、SQL(结构化查询语言)等。导入工具通常会根据指定的导入格式解析数据文件,并将数据插入到数据库中的相应表中。

    3. 导入数据的方式:导入数据可以采用多种方式,如命令行导入、图形界面导入等。命令行导入通常需要编写相应的导入脚本或命令,指定要导入的数据文件和目标数据库。图形界面导入通常提供了更直观的操作界面,可以通过拖拽文件或选择文件来导入数据。

    4. 数据导入的注意事项:在导入数据时,需要注意以下几点:

      • 确保目标数据库的表结构与导入数据的结构一致,否则可能导致数据插入失败或数据不完整。
      • 对于大量数据的导入,需要考虑性能问题,可以通过批量插入或分批导入的方式来提高导入速度。
      • 在导入之前,可以进行数据清洗和验证,确保导入的数据符合数据库的要求和业务规则。
    5. 导入数据的应用场景:数据库导入在实际应用中有着广泛的应用。例如,当一个公司从旧系统迁移到新系统时,可以通过导入数据将旧系统中的数据转移到新系统中;当多个部门或团队的数据需要合并时,可以通过导入数据将各个部门或团队的数据合并到一个统一的数据库中。此外,导入数据还可以用于数据库备份和恢复,以及数据分析和报表生成等应用。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    导入数据库指的是将外部数据或者备份文件导入到数据库中的操作。在数据库管理系统中,通常有以下几种方式来导入数据:

    1. SQL命令行工具:通过使用数据库管理系统提供的命令行工具,如MySQL的mysql命令或者PostgreSQL的psql命令,可以直接执行SQL语句来导入数据。这种方式适用于较小的数据量或者仅需要导入部分数据的情况。

    2. 数据库客户端工具:常见的数据库客户端工具如Navicat、DBeaver等,它们提供了可视化的界面,可以方便地导入数据。通过这些工具,用户可以选择导入的文件类型(如CSV、Excel等),指定目标表格,映射字段等,从而完成数据导入。

    3. 数据库备份与恢复工具:数据库管理系统通常提供了备份与恢复工具,如MySQL的mysqldump命令或者PostgreSQL的pg_dump命令。通过使用这些工具,可以将数据库的数据和结构导出为备份文件,然后再通过相应的恢复工具将备份文件导入到数据库中。

    4. ETL工具:ETL(Extract, Transform, Load)工具可以帮助用户从多个数据源中提取数据,进行转换和处理,然后加载到目标数据库中。常见的ETL工具有Talend、Informatica等。通过这些工具,用户可以通过可视化界面配置数据源、数据转换规则和目标数据库等,从而实现自动化的数据导入。

    总结来说,导入数据库的东西可以是SQL命令行工具、数据库客户端工具、数据库备份与恢复工具或者ETL工具,具体选择哪种方式取决于数据量的大小、导入需求的复杂程度以及个人的偏好。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    导入数据库是指将数据从外部文件或其他数据库中导入到目标数据库中的过程。在数据库管理系统中,通常会提供一些工具或方法来导入数据。下面将从方法和操作流程两个方面进行讲解。

    一、方法:

    1. 使用数据库管理系统提供的导入工具:大多数数据库管理系统(如MySQL、Oracle、SQL Server等)都提供了导入工具,可以通过这些工具来导入数据。这些工具通常会提供图形界面和命令行两种方式,用户可以根据需要选择合适的方式进行操作。

    2. 使用SQL语句导入数据:除了使用数据库管理系统提供的导入工具外,还可以使用SQL语句来导入数据。一般情况下,可以使用INSERT INTO语句将数据逐条插入到目标表中,但如果数据量较大,这种方式可能会比较耗时。为了提高导入效率,可以考虑使用LOAD DATA INFILE语句或BULK INSERT语句,这些语句可以一次性导入大量数据。

    3. 使用ETL工具导入数据:ETL(Extract-Transform-Load)工具是一种专门用于数据抽取、转换和加载的软件工具。通过配置连接源数据和目标数据库,并定义数据转换规则,可以方便地将数据从源数据源导入到目标数据库中。常见的ETL工具有Informatica、DataStage、Talend等。

    二、操作流程:

    1. 准备源数据:首先需要准备好要导入的源数据,这可以是一个外部文件(如CSV、Excel、XML等),或者是另一个数据库中的数据。

    2. 创建目标表:在目标数据库中创建一个与源数据相匹配的表结构。表的字段和数据类型应与源数据一致,以确保数据导入的准确性。

    3. 选择导入方法:根据实际情况选择合适的导入方法,可以是使用数据库管理系统提供的导入工具,也可以是使用SQL语句或ETL工具。

    4. 导入数据:根据选择的导入方法,执行相应的操作来导入数据。如果使用数据库管理系统提供的导入工具,通常需要选择源文件或源数据库,并设置导入的目标表和其他相关参数。如果使用SQL语句导入数据,可以编写相应的INSERT INTO、LOAD DATA INFILE或BULK INSERT语句,并执行它们来导入数据。如果使用ETL工具导入数据,需要配置连接源数据和目标数据库,并定义数据转换规则,然后执行导入任务。

    5. 验证导入结果:导入完成后,需要对导入的数据进行验证,确保数据的准确性和完整性。可以查询目标表,检查导入的数据是否与源数据一致。

    以上是导入数据库的方法和操作流程的简要介绍,具体的步骤和操作可能会因数据库管理系统或工具的不同而有所差异,但总体思路是相似的。在实际操作中,需要根据具体的情况选择合适的方法和工具,并遵循相应的操作流程来完成数据导入任务。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部